¿Alguna vez has escuchado sobre la programación por bloques y te preguntas qué tipos existen? En este artículo, te explicaremos detalladamente los diferentes tipos de programación por bloques que puedes encontrar en el mundo de la tecnología. ¡Sigue leyendo para descubrir más!
¿Qué es la Programación por Bloques?
Antes de sumergirnos en los tipos de programación por bloques, es importante entender en qué consiste este enfoque. La programación por bloques es una metodología que permite crear programas informáticos utilizando bloques gráficos que representan diferentes funciones y acciones. Estos bloques se pueden arrastrar y soltar en un entorno de desarrollo visual, facilitando la creación de código de una manera intuitiva y accesible.
Tipos de Programación por Bloques
1. Scratch
Scratch es una de las plataformas de programación por bloques más populares, especialmente entre los niños y principiantes en programación. Con Scratch, los usuarios pueden crear historias interactivas, juegos y animaciones utilizando bloques de código visual.
2. Blockly
Blockly es otra herramienta de programación por bloques que se utiliza en diversos proyectos educativos y de desarrollo de software. Ofrece una interfaz amigable que permite a los usuarios crear código de forma sencilla y visual.
3. App Inventor
App Inventor es una plataforma de programación por bloques desarrollada por Google que se centra en la creación de aplicaciones móviles para dispositivos Android. Con App Inventor, los usuarios pueden diseñar y desarrollar sus propias apps sin necesidad de tener conocimientos avanzados de programación.
Beneficios de la Programación por Bloques
La programación por bloques presenta numerosos beneficios, especialmente para aquellos que están dando sus primeros pasos en el mundo de la programación. Algunas ventajas incluyen:
- Facilidad de aprendizaje
- Visualización clara del código
- Mayor interactividad
- Potencial para la creatividad
Conclusión
En resumen, los tipos de programación por bloques ofrecen una forma accesible y divertida de introducirse en el mundo de la programación. Ya sea a través de plataformas como Scratch, Blockly o App Inventor, los usuarios pueden desarrollar habilidades de codificación de manera visual y práctica. ¡Anímate a explorar estos recursos y descubrir todo lo que la programación por bloques tiene para ofrecer!
Esperamos que este artículo haya sido útil para comprender los diferentes tipos de programación por bloques disponibles. Si tienes alguna pregunta o comentario, ¡no dudes en compartirlo con nosotros!